## Idempotency Keys for Payment Retries (Lumopay)

Every retry of a charge request must reuse the original idempotency key; generating a new key on retry can produce duplicate charges. Keys are scoped per merchant and expire after 48 hours. Reviewers should verify keys are derived server-side, never from client input. The full key-generation specification and threat model are maintained on the internal page.

dashboard of kaguf-tawip = https://vault.merlaqsys.test/issue

Meeting notes — Pipeline Review, Thornbury Docs Team

We walked through the markdown rendering pipeline end to end. Key concerns: the sanitizer occasionally strips nested tables, and the cache layer serves stale renders after template updates. Agreed actions: add a cache-bust hook on template deploys and expand sanitizer test coverage before next release. On-call should page out rather than patch live. The engineer accountable for these follow-ups is named below.

account owner for bawip-tahag: Raleth Quenok

The Fluxhaven Gateway supports permessage-deflate on all websocket channels, but plugin authors should weigh the tradeoffs carefully. Compression reduces bandwidth on chatty event streams by roughly 60%, yet adds measurable CPU overhead and per-connection memory for the sliding window. For small, frequent frames the savings rarely justify the cost, so we recommend disabling it below 512-byte payloads. To benchmark both modes against the staging gateway, authenticate with the following credential.

session JWT of yawep-yawep = eyJhbGciOiJIUzI1NiIsInR5cCI6IkpXVCJ9.eyJzdWIiOiI3pWF3_In0.aXYsHiog